Nevertheless, she was not forgotten. In the mid-1950s, MGM made the movie, Love Me or Leave Me, starring Doris Day as Ruth and James Cagney as Moe Snyder. Although not exactly historically accurate -- when has that ever bothered Hollywood? -- the movie was a great success. Doris Day received great reviews for her performance, and you can still see the movie and hear many of the songs that Ruth Etting made famous on classic movie channels such as Turner Classic Movies.
